What’s with the term? What is al fresco dining?

Al fresco is an Italian term that means “in the fresh air” or “in the shade.” Dining al fresco simply means eating outside or out in the open air. But you shouldn’t confuse it with going on a picnic and eating at the park while sitting on a blanket. Al fresco dining typically involves comfortable seating, refined tablescapes, and a casual yet party-like atmosphere. 

What does al fresco dining include?

Al fresco dining can take many forms and happen anywhere—from cafes and gastropubs to lavish restaurants. But generally, here are the ever-present elements of this type of dining:

  • Outdoor setting: A defining characteristic of an al fresco dining experience is it takes place out in the open air. So when you dine out and are offered to eat al fresco, you can expect to be seated on a patio, terrace, or rooftop bar. 
  • Warm weather: Restaurants usually offer al fresco during warm weather or patio season. It’s a good way to experience the cheerful weather with your loved ones. Some patios are heated to ensure a good temperature during breezy summer nights.
  • Casual party-like atmosphere: Patios and terraces for al fresco dining are often decked with lounge furniture, plants, umbrellas, awnings, and other elements that make the space casual and welcoming. These spaces can usually seat ten or more to truly create a party-like atmosphere perfect for hanging out or people-watching.

Dining Out: 10 Must-Try Patios in Yorkville

Yorkville isn’t only known for its upscale boutiques, beautiful homes, and bustling culture—it’s also home to some of the most interesting restaurants in Toronto, Ontario. Despite its small area, Yorkville boasts restaurants that offer a diverse range of cuisines. Visiting this neighborhood means you can eat Lebanese cuisine and grab gelato after. 

 

Moreso, Yorkville is full of restaurants that offer lovely alfresco dining. If you’re dining out this patio season, you should check out this list of some of the must-try patios in Yorkville.

 

  • Blu Ristorante

Blu Ristorante offers contemporary Italian cuisine and a wine bar right there in the heart of Yorkville. The modern decor of this restaurant is warm & inviting, but nothing beats its beautiful lush patio. Dining out on this patio will make you feel as if you were away. Your terrific dining experience will even be enhanced by the restaurant’s soothing live music.

  • Amal

Looking for a modern Lebanese restaurant in Toronto? Check out Amal in Yorkville. Its food is heavily rooted in culture while making a nod to new traditions. It also has a stunning and heated second-floor terrace that overlooks Bloor Street. Enjoy delicious Lebanese food while hanging out on this terrace decked with plants, pillows, and multiple lounge furniture pieces. 

  • The Pilot

The Pilot was originally a clubhouse for musicians, artists, and writers. Today, it still has an artsy ambiance, but it’s now a multi-level pub with an aviation theme. Apart from its main floor front patio, it also has a vibrant, spacious & heated rooftop patio called the Flight Deck. Climb to the Flight Deck and enjoy drinking draft beers and listening to live jazz music.

  • Kasa Moto 

Offering contemporary & flavor-packed Japanese food, Kasa Moto is a gem in Yorkville. It also offers two options for outdoor dining. You can either dine at a street-level terrace or go up to the rooftop patio. The sprawling rooftop patio is decked with its own bar, space heaters, and cabanas. Dine here at night, and you can enjoy delicious sushi while gazing at the stars.


  • Bar Reyna

Situated in a two-story Victorian house, Bar Reyna is a cocktail & snack bar that delivers sumptuous Mediterranean-inspired snacks and signature cocktails. It may have a small facade, but it offers plenty of alfresco dining. It features a gorgeous front patio, along with a spacious backyard patio that can seat 48 people. Try Lamb Baklava when you visit here. 

  • The Oxley

A fan of the traditional British pub? Go to The Oxley! It’s a gastropub that offers classic British pub fare—from fish and chips to traditional cask ales. It also has two patios. The front patio is on street level with a view of the Hazelton Hotel, while the courtyard offers a more intimate atmosphere. So go and grab a pint, choose a patio and enjoy your afternoon.

  • Sofia

Sofia has created the perfect space for food, art, and drink. It offers contemporary yet nostalgic Italian dishes in a restaurant space that shares a constantly curated art gallery. You can check out the art pieces before sitting and enjoying delectable pasta and wine. Plus, it features an atmospheric patio that makes for an elevated al fresco dining experience.

  • Sassafraz

Located in an array of Victorian rowhouses, Sassafraz is a gorgeous restaurant that offers irresistible French-inspired Canadian cuisine, wine, and cocktails. Apart from its lovely interiors, it has a shaded and romantic patio. It’s a perfect place to enjoy sumptuous dishes while people-watching or celebrity-spotting. 

  • Cibo Wine Bar

Cibo Wine Bar brings its southern Italian cooking to Yorkville. Here, you can enjoy handmade fresh pasta, delectable pizza, and other traditional Italian food. The restaurant offers two al fresco dining options. It has a side patio for an intimate dining experience. But if you want to be out in the open, you can stay on the street patio with umbrellas and shades.

  • ONE Restaurant

Preferred a charming candlelit patio for your romantic dinner? Go to ONE Restaurant at The Hazelton Hotel. Its tree-lined patio is the perfect place to indulge in a lavish dining experience while welcoming the patio season. Have a plate of branzino or filet mignon while drinking a glass of wine and enjoying your al fresco dining experience with your loved one.

At the intersection of Yonge and Bloor in downtown Toronto, you will discover Yorkville, an upscale neighborhood where the rich and famous love to shop and dine. Also known as the Mink Mile, the neighborhood is home to several art galleries, museums, high-end boutiques, and some of the best restaurants in Toronto.

Many people do not know that the neighborhood was once a mecca for musicians and hippies in the 1960s. Even today, you can find licensed bands playing in the Cumberland park on any weekend. However, the modern Yorkville has transformed itself into a hub of retail therapy with high-end shops and fashion boutiques.

  2. Yorkville Museums –  The neighborhood has some amazing museums worth a visit. You can spend an entire day in the Royal Ontario Museum (ROM) watching exhibits that give you an insight into the city’s history and culture. The Bata Shoe Museum has the world’s largest collection of footwear and related items.   Another popular museum worth visiting is the Gardiner museum that boasts an amazing collection of ceramics used throughout civilization. If all that learning makes you hungry, pamper your taste buds at one of the best Yorkville restaurants.
  3. Yorkville Parks – The Village of Yorkville Park consists of a series of well-maintained gardens that are good spots to rest or just to do some people watching. The numerous parks offer a much-needed respite from the hustle-bustle of the neighborhood. They celebrate the history of Yorkville and showcase the best of the Canadian landscape. Some of the best neighborhood parks are the Jesse Ketchum Park, the Frank Stollery Park, and the Town Hall Square.
